Easy Rectangular to Polar Complex Numbers Calculator Online


Easy Rectangular to Polar Complex Numbers Calculator Online

A computational tool exists for transforming complex numbers expressed in Cartesian form (a + bi) into their equivalent polar representation (r(cos + i sin ) or rei). This conversion process involves determining the magnitude (r), which represents the distance from the origin to the point in the complex plane, and the argument (), which represents the angle formed with the positive real axis. For instance, the complex number 3 + 4i, when processed through this method, yields a magnitude of 5 and an argument approximately equal to 0.927 radians.

Such a conversion utility is beneficial in various scientific and engineering applications. It simplifies mathematical operations, especially multiplication, division, and exponentiation of complex numbers. In electrical engineering, it aids in analyzing alternating current circuits; in signal processing, it facilitates the manipulation of signals in the frequency domain. Historically, while manual methods were employed, computerized implementations significantly enhance speed and accuracy in these conversions, enabling more complex analyses.

The subsequent sections will delve into the mathematical foundations of this transformation, the algorithms employed in its implementation, practical considerations for ensuring accuracy, and examples of its use across different fields.

1. Magnitude Calculation

Magnitude calculation is a fundamental component of the transformation from rectangular to polar coordinates for complex numbers. The process determines the absolute value, or modulus, of the complex number, representing its distance from the origin of the complex plane. The magnitude, denoted as ‘r’, is mathematically derived using the Pythagorean theorem: r = (a + b), where ‘a’ is the real part and ‘b’ is the imaginary part of the complex number (a + bi). Without accurate magnitude calculation, the resulting polar representation is inherently flawed, rendering subsequent operations or analyses based on it invalid. For instance, in electrical engineering, if the magnitude of a complex impedance is incorrectly calculated, circuit analysis becomes unreliable, potentially leading to design flaws or inaccurate predictions of circuit behavior.

Consider the complex number 4 + 3i. Accurate magnitude calculation yields r = (4 + 3) = (16 + 9) = 25 = 5. If a “rectangular to polar complex numbers calculator” employs an algorithm that produces an incorrect magnitude, for example, 4, the polar representation would be inaccurate. This error would propagate through any subsequent calculations involving the complex number, potentially affecting outcomes in fields like signal processing, where accurate representation of signal amplitudes is vital. In signal processing, for example, amplitude accuracy is critical for reconstruction in signal processing applications.

In summary, the integrity of the transformation from rectangular to polar form hinges on precise magnitude calculation. Any inaccuracies introduced during this step directly impact the validity and utility of the resulting polar representation. Challenges in achieving accuracy often stem from computational limitations in handling very large or very small numbers, necessitating robust numerical methods within the computational tool. The reliability of “rectangular to polar complex numbers calculator” directly depends on the correctness of magnitude calculation.

2. Angle Determination

Angle determination is an indispensable function within a tool that converts complex numbers from rectangular to polar form. This process calculates the argument of the complex number, representing the angle it makes with the positive real axis in the complex plane. Precise angle calculation is paramount for the accurate polar representation necessary in various mathematical and engineering applications.

  • Arctangent Function Usage

    The principal method for angle determination involves the arctangent function (arctan or tan-1). This function provides the angle whose tangent is the ratio of the imaginary part to the real part of the complex number (b/a). However, the standard arctangent function has a range of (-/2, /2), necessitating adjustments to ensure the angle is correctly placed in the appropriate quadrant. Failure to account for the correct quadrant results in an incorrect polar representation, affecting subsequent calculations. For example, the complex numbers 1 + i and -1 – i both have a b/a ratio of 1, but their angles are /4 and -3/4 respectively. Incorrect arctangent usage leads to confusion in radio navigation and signal processing.

  • Quadrant Correction

    Quadrant correction is a crucial step following the initial arctangent calculation. The complex plane is divided into four quadrants, each requiring a specific adjustment to the angle obtained from the arctangent function. If ‘a’ (the real part) is positive, the angle is the arctangent value. If ‘a’ is negative and ‘b’ (the imaginary part) is positive, is added to the arctangent value. If ‘a’ is negative and ‘b’ is negative, – is added to the arctangent value. If ‘a’ is zero and ‘b’ is positive, the angle is /2. If ‘a’ is zero and ‘b’ is negative, the angle is -/2. Inaccurate quadrant correction leads to errors in applications such as radar systems.

  • Range Normalization

    Following quadrant correction, the angle may need to be normalized to fit a specific range, typically [-, ] or [0, 2]. Normalization ensures consistency and facilitates comparisons between different complex numbers. This is achieved by adding or subtracting multiples of 2 until the angle falls within the desired range. Without normalization, angles may be represented as excessively large or negative values, complicating interpretations and calculations. For instance, an angle of 5/2 is equivalent to /2, and normalization ensures the latter representation is used. This process affects signal processing algorithms that rely on phase information.

  • Computational Considerations

    The arctangent function is computationally intensive, particularly when implemented in embedded systems or real-time applications. Approximations and optimized algorithms are often employed to reduce computational load while maintaining acceptable accuracy. Additionally, special cases, such as when the real part ‘a’ is zero, require careful handling to avoid division by zero errors. The choice of algorithm for arctangent calculation and the handling of special cases directly impact the performance and reliability of the transformation tool. Optimized algorithms contribute to accurate radar signal processing.

These facets of angle determination underscore its significance in the context of transforming complex numbers from rectangular to polar form. Correct implementation of these aspects is essential for the accuracy and utility of the resulting polar representation. The precision of “rectangular to polar complex numbers calculator” directly depends on these computations.

3. Quadrant Awareness

Quadrant awareness is a critical component in the functionality of a tool designed to convert complex numbers from rectangular to polar form. The arctangent function, frequently used in this conversion, possesses a limited range, typically (-/2, /2). Consequently, it can only directly provide angles within the first and fourth quadrants. Without explicit quadrant awareness, the resulting polar representation will be ambiguous and potentially incorrect.

The complex plane is divided into four quadrants, each characterized by the signs of the real and imaginary components of a complex number. The first quadrant features positive real and imaginary parts, the second has a negative real part and a positive imaginary part, the third has negative real and imaginary parts, and the fourth has a positive real part and a negative imaginary part. A “rectangular to polar complex numbers calculator” must incorporate logic to discern the correct quadrant based on the signs of the input components and then adjust the angle accordingly. For instance, if a complex number has a negative real part and a positive imaginary part (second quadrant), the tool must add to the result of the arctangent function to obtain the correct angle. Failure to do so leads to an angular representation that is reflected across the y-axis, which can be problematic in applications such as signal processing where phase information is vital. For example, consider the complex numbers 1 + i and -1 + i. Both have a b/a absolute ratio of 1, but the arctangent function will return the same angle for both. Correct quadrant awareness ensures that the angle for -1 + i is adjusted by adding , thus distinguishing it from the angle for 1 + i.

In summary, quadrant awareness is essential for the correct determination of the angle in the polar representation of a complex number. A “rectangular to polar complex numbers calculator” that neglects this consideration will produce inaccurate results, undermining its utility in applications that depend on precise phase information. The correct implementation involves examining the signs of the real and imaginary components and applying appropriate corrections to the angle obtained from the arctangent function. Proper quadrant determination directly influences the reliability of “rectangular to polar complex numbers calculator”.

4. Accuracy Considerations

The operation of a transformation tool from rectangular to polar complex numbers necessitates a high degree of accuracy to ensure the reliability of subsequent calculations and analyses. Inaccurate conversions can lead to erroneous results in various applications, ranging from electrical engineering to signal processing. Several factors contribute to potential inaccuracies, including the precision of the underlying algorithms, the handling of floating-point arithmetic, and the presence of numerical instability.

One primary source of error stems from the limited precision of floating-point representations in computer systems. Operations involving trigonometric functions, square roots, and division can accumulate small errors, particularly when dealing with complex numbers close to the origin. These errors, though seemingly insignificant, can propagate through subsequent calculations, leading to substantial deviations from expected outcomes. For example, in signal processing, a small error in the phase angle of a complex Fourier coefficient can distort the reconstructed signal. Similarly, in electrical engineering, inaccuracies in impedance calculations can lead to incorrect predictions of circuit behavior. Algorithms must employ strategies to minimize these effects, such as using higher-precision data types or implementing error compensation techniques. The calculator’s accuracy significantly influences navigation and signal processing.

Furthermore, numerical instability can arise when dealing with complex numbers that have very large or very small magnitudes. In such cases, the range limitations of floating-point numbers can lead to loss of precision or overflow errors. Robust algorithms incorporate scaling or normalization techniques to mitigate these issues. In summary, accuracy considerations are paramount to the design and implementation of a reliable rectangular to polar complex numbers converter. Without careful attention to these details, the resulting polar representation may be inaccurate, undermining the value of the tool in practical applications. Proper numerical methods are vital for trustworthy radar signal processing.

5. Computational Efficiency

Computational efficiency is a crucial attribute of any practical implementation of a “rectangular to polar complex numbers calculator.” The speed and resource consumption associated with the conversion process directly impact the feasibility of using such a tool in real-time systems or applications involving large datasets. An inefficient algorithm can become a bottleneck, limiting overall system performance.

  • Algorithmic Optimization

    Algorithmic optimization constitutes a primary approach to enhancing computational efficiency. Specific algorithms can be chosen or refined to reduce the number of operations required for the conversion. For example, utilizing lookup tables for common trigonometric values, rather than computing them on demand, can significantly reduce processing time. In signal processing applications requiring frequent conversions, even small improvements in algorithmic efficiency can result in substantial performance gains. The calculator’s design dictates its applicability in such cases.

  • Hardware Acceleration

    Employing hardware acceleration techniques offers another pathway to improved computational efficiency. Field-Programmable Gate Arrays (FPGAs) or specialized digital signal processors (DSPs) can be utilized to perform the complex number conversions in parallel, thereby drastically reducing the processing time compared to software implementations on general-purpose processors. Radar systems, which require real-time signal processing, often rely on hardware acceleration for this type of transformation.

  • Data Representation

    The chosen data representation format directly influences computational efficiency. For example, using single-precision floating-point numbers may provide sufficient accuracy for some applications while requiring less memory and processing time compared to double-precision numbers. Selecting the appropriate data type based on the application’s accuracy requirements is essential. In embedded systems with limited resources, careful consideration of data representation is critical.

  • Parallel Processing

    Exploiting parallel processing architectures provides a method for executing multiple conversions concurrently. Multi-core processors or distributed computing systems can divide the workload, processing different complex numbers simultaneously. This approach is particularly beneficial when dealing with large datasets or in simulations requiring numerous conversions. Efficient parallelization strategies can significantly improve the throughput of “rectangular to polar complex numbers calculator” in computationally intensive tasks.

These facets underscore the importance of computational efficiency in the design and implementation of a “rectangular to polar complex numbers calculator.” Optimizations at the algorithmic, hardware, data representation, and architectural levels are crucial for enabling the tool to meet the demands of real-world applications. Trade-offs between accuracy, speed, and resource consumption must be carefully considered to achieve optimal performance. This is especially true for embedded or real-time applications.

6. Application Scope

The utility of a tool that transforms complex numbers from rectangular to polar form is intrinsically linked to its application scope. The breadth and depth of its applicability determine its value and relevance across diverse scientific and engineering disciplines. A wider application scope signifies a more versatile and impactful tool, capable of addressing a broader range of problems and challenges. The “rectangular to polar complex numbers calculator” finds application where complex number representation and manipulation are essential, as elaborated below.

Electrical engineering relies heavily on this transformation in circuit analysis, particularly for alternating current (AC) circuits. Impedance, a complex quantity representing the opposition to current flow, is frequently expressed in polar form to simplify calculations involving voltage, current, and power. Signal processing utilizes complex numbers to represent signals in the frequency domain. The transformation facilitates operations like filtering, modulation, and demodulation. Control systems engineering employs complex numbers in stability analysis. The transformation aids in determining system stability based on the location of poles and zeros in the complex plane. These applications highlight the practical significance of such a tool; limitations in its application scope restrict its usefulness. Moreover, in fields like quantum mechanics, complex numbers are fundamental to wave function representation and calculations. The transformation is crucial for simplifying calculations related to wave propagation, interference, and diffraction.

In conclusion, the application scope dictates the importance and benefits of a “rectangular to polar complex numbers calculator.” A tool with broad applicability serves as a valuable asset across numerous domains, streamlining calculations, simplifying analyses, and enabling more sophisticated problem-solving. The practical challenges associated with ensuring a wide application scope involve designing a tool that is accurate, efficient, and robust across a wide range of input values and computational environments.

Frequently Asked Questions

This section addresses common inquiries regarding the conversion of complex numbers from rectangular to polar representation.

Question 1: Why is the conversion from rectangular to polar form necessary?

The conversion simplifies mathematical operations, particularly multiplication, division, and exponentiation, when dealing with complex numbers. Polar form provides a more intuitive representation for magnitude and phase characteristics, facilitating analysis in fields like electrical engineering and signal processing.

Question 2: What are the core mathematical principles behind the transformation?

The transformation relies on the Pythagorean theorem to calculate the magnitude (r = (a + b)) and the arctangent function to determine the argument ( = arctan(b/a)), with appropriate quadrant adjustments to ensure the correct angle.

Question 3: How does the “rectangular to polar complex numbers calculator” address quadrant ambiguity?

The tool must incorporate logic to determine the correct quadrant based on the signs of the real and imaginary components of the complex number. It then applies appropriate corrections to the angle obtained from the arctangent function.

Question 4: What accuracy considerations are paramount in such a tool?

Accuracy depends on the precision of the algorithms, the handling of floating-point arithmetic, and mitigation of numerical instability, especially when dealing with complex numbers close to the origin or with very large/small magnitudes.

Question 5: What measures are taken to ensure computational efficiency?

Computational efficiency is achieved through algorithmic optimizations, hardware acceleration (where applicable), selection of appropriate data representations, and exploitation of parallel processing architectures.

Question 6: In what practical applications is the tool most beneficial?

The tool finds application across diverse fields, including electrical engineering (circuit analysis), signal processing (signal representation and manipulation), control systems engineering (stability analysis), and quantum mechanics (wave function calculations).

In summary, the successful conversion of complex numbers from rectangular to polar form hinges on mathematical accuracy, quadrant awareness, and computational efficiency. The tool serves a wide range of applications within scientific and engineering domains.

The next section will cover tips and best practices for utilizing the “rectangular to polar complex numbers calculator” effectively.

Tips for Using a Rectangular to Polar Complex Numbers Calculator

The following guidelines aim to optimize the utilization of a conversion tool, enhancing accuracy and efficiency in the transformation process.

Tip 1: Validate Input Data: Ensure that the real and imaginary components of the complex number are entered correctly. Transposition or typographical errors can lead to significant inaccuracies in the resulting polar form.

Tip 2: Understand Quadrant Conventions: Be aware of the quadrant in which the complex number resides. Verify that the calculator correctly adjusts the argument based on the signs of the real and imaginary components. Manual verification may be required for critical applications.

Tip 3: Confirm Output Units: Verify whether the calculator expresses the argument in degrees or radians. Consistency in unit usage is essential for accurate calculations and interpretations.

Tip 4: Assess Magnitude Precision: Evaluate the magnitude (r) for reasonableness. Significant deviations from expected values indicate potential input errors or calculator malfunctions.

Tip 5: Inspect Angle Representation: Confirm that the angle is normalized to fall within a standard range, typically [-, ] or [0, 2]. Unnormalized angles can complicate comparisons and further calculations.

Tip 6: Consider Numerical Limitations: Be cognizant of the potential for numerical errors when dealing with very large or very small complex numbers. Employ appropriate scaling or normalization techniques to mitigate these effects.

Tip 7: Cross-Validate Results: For critical applications, cross-validate the results obtained from the calculator using alternative methods or software tools. This provides an independent verification of accuracy.

Adherence to these tips can improve the reliability of the transformation process and minimize the risk of errors in subsequent analyses. The tool’s effectiveness is maximized through a combination of accurate input, careful interpretation of output, and awareness of potential limitations.

The subsequent section will provide a comprehensive summary, reiterating the core concepts and emphasizing the benefits of the rectangular to polar transformation for complex numbers.

Conclusion

The preceding analysis clarifies the essential role a “rectangular to polar complex numbers calculator” plays in diverse fields. The tool’s utility extends beyond mere conversion, facilitating simplified mathematical operations and intuitive data representation, particularly in electrical engineering, signal processing, and quantum mechanics. Accurate magnitude and angle determination, rigorous quadrant awareness, and optimized computational efficiency are critical factors determining the reliability and applicability of such a tool.

The ongoing advancement of computational methods promises further enhancements in the accuracy and speed of these transformations. Continued refinement of algorithms and hardware acceleration techniques will expand the tool’s capabilities and solidify its position as an indispensable asset for scientific and engineering endeavors. The development and implementation of robust, efficient conversion tools remains a vital pursuit.